The hidden room that becomes what you need -- it housed Dumbledore's Army as a resistance base, connected to the Hog's Head for supplies, hid Ravenclaw's diadem for decades, and burned in Fiendfyre.
The Room of Requirement served as the resistance headquarters during the Carrow regime. Neville and the DA lived here when the dormitories became too dangerous. A passage through Ariana Dumbledore's portrait connected to the Hog's Head, where Aberforth supplied food and smuggled people in and out. During the Battle, Harry entered the Room of Hidden Things to find Ravenclaw's diadem. Draco, Crabbe, and Goyle followed. Crabbe cast Fiendfyre -- cursed fire that cannot be controlled -- and the room became an inferno. Harry rescued Draco (and Goyle). Crabbe died in his own fire. The diadem was destroyed, though not by design. The room was gutted by the Fiendfyre and may never function again.
Changes based on need. As the DA hideout: hammocks, Dumbledore's Army banners, a tunnel to the Hog's Head, Ariana Dumbledore's portrait serving as a door. As the Room of Hidden Things: a cathedral-sized labyrinth of centuries of junk where the diadem Horcrux sat unnoticed. After the fire: gutted, ruined, the ceiling collapsed.
